I can successfully run ideviceinfo and idevicepair to confirm the usb-passthrough is working.
I just started the default new xtool project named "Hello" following the installation guide.
But everytime I try to run xtool dev it gives me muxError after the connecting stage.

"[Unpacking app] 100%
[Preparing device] 100%
[Provisioning] 100%
[Signing] 100%
[Packaging] 100%
[Connecting] 100%
Error: muxError"

I´ve attempted using two different cables and three different usb ports at the back of my pc.

Environment

Host OS:
Windows 11
WSL version: 2.5.9.0
Ubuntu 24.04.1 LTS

iOS device version:
iPhone 12, developer mode enabled.
18.2.1

Swift version:
6.1.2 (swift-6.1.2-RELEASE)

Libmobiledevice is installed:
sudo apt-get install usbmuxd libimobiledevice6 libimobiledevice-utils

usbipd installed.
Apple Devices and Apple Music installed.

SDK version:
xcode 16.3

xtool 1.13.0
